refinance Highlights Refinancers may need 25 percent equity to get qualified residential mortgages. A proposed rule might make refinancing with less equity more costly. The rule isn’t final and won’t be in effect for at least a year. Homeowners who need to refinance an existing mortgage, but don’t have substantial equity, might want to act [...]

Ranchi, March 28:  The flow of Nabard refinance in Jharkhand has been declining over the last three years, according to the Jharkhand Economic Survey 2010-11. As indicated in the National Bank for Agriculture and Rural Development’s (Nabard’s) Jharkhand State Focus Paper 2010-11, disbursement of refinance has come down from Rs 77.47 crore in 2006-07 to [...]

AUSTRALIAN companies will have to raise about $ 60 billion to refinance debt maturing in the next five years, an amount Moody’s Investors Service believes is manageable. The credit rating agency said the amount of debt refinancing facing rated corporate issuers in Australia should be “manageable,” provided the sector continues to demonstrate “proactive management” of [...]

 The Obama administration has given another year of life to an foreclosure prevention program allowing certain borrowers to refinance underwater mortgages owned or guaranteed by Freddie Mac and Fannie Mae. The Home Affordable Refinance Program had been set to expire June 30. HARP, as it’s known, will now continue through June 2012. With 30-year fixed-rate mortages below [...]

WASHINGTON – Republicans pushed a bill through the House on Thursday killing assistance for people who want to refinance homes that are worth less than they paid for them. The mostly party-line vote, 256-171, came despite a White House veto threat against the measure. The bill killing the Federal Housing Administration Refinance Program stands scant [...]
